Overview

As a Digital Marketing Manager, you will be responsible for developing, implementing and managing digital marketing campaigns that promote FWI and its products and services. You will play a major role in enhancing brand awareness within the digital space, driving website traffic and ultimately acquiring leads and driving pipeline growth.  You will work with the Director of Marketing and FWI’s outside agency to identify and evaluate new digital technologies and use analytics tools to better optimize marketing campaigns, email marketing, social media, and display and search advertising. You aren’t afraid to try new things, take chances, fail and test everything.   

Responsibilities

  • Drive relevant leads through digital marketing with the goal of generating leads, increasing brand recognition and growing pipeline
  • Plan and execute all digital marketing, including SEO/SEM, marketing database, email, social media and display advertising campaigns
  • Monitor, extract and report on important data points throughout the lifecycle of each campaign and assess against goals (ROI and KPIs)
  • Identify trends and insights, and optimize spend and performance based on the insights
  • Brainstorm new and creative growth strategies
  • Plan, execute, and measure experiments and conversion tests
  • Collaborate with internal teams to create landing pages and optimize user experience
  • Design, build and maintain our social media presence with a heavy focus on lead generation
  • Collaborate closely with all marketing team members to ensure all efforts are tightly aligned
  • Utilize strong analytical ability to evaluate end-to-end user experience across multiple channels and touch points
  • Collaborate with agencies and other vendor partners
  • Evaluate emerging technologies. Provide ideas and perspective for adoption where appropriate
  • Assist in the strategy and execution of trade shows and events including pre-show marketing, event logistics, social media promotion before and during each event, and post-show analysis.
